How Free Dvd Burning Software for Mac OS X Works

At its core, this software lets users convert digital filesโ€”movies, presentations, music, or educational DVDsโ€”into physical discs using intuitive drag-and-drop interfaces. Unlike complex tools requiring deep technical knowledge, it automates key steps: selecting a disc format, formatting options, transferring data, and creating ISO images. The process is optimized for Mac OS X, ensuring compatibility with recent and current versions while keeping installation simple and lightweight. Users can preview burns before finalizing, reducing errors and enhancing satisfaction.
